Kerala Tourism launches revamped website

Thiruvananthapuram: Kerala Tourism today launched its revamped website, marking a vital step in bolstering the state’s efforts to meet global competition in the tourism sector. Leveraging cutting-edge technology, the website creates a comprehensive digital guide with information in more than 20 languages.

Launching the updated website, www.keralatourism.org here, Tourism Minister, Shri P A Mohamed Riyas said the user-friendly and interactive portal will showcase the immense possibilities of Kerala as a tourism destination which will be available in a novel way at the fingertips of tourists from any part of the world. He added that the tourist-friendly web portal will help visitors easily find certified hotels, homestays, Ayurveda and wellness centres in Kerala.

The Minister added that in 2023-24 alone, the website had around one crore visitors and more than two crores page views. The upgraded website, which is available in over 20 languages, is a comprehensive digital guide that features the state’s unique attractions, culture and heritage and travel information.

This will offer a seamless web browsing experience for users in various gadgets like computers, tablets and mobile. The revamped website also provides easy navigation to tourism-related topics and an improved multimedia playback for users.

Apart from newly-added pages, the content has been created with SEO optimisation. Other highlights of the website are high-resolution pictures with attractive videos and packages with new layout. The interactive pages are equipped with riveting features like travel planner, live webcast, video quiz and e-newsletters. Through the user-generated content (UGC) facility on the web portal, travellers can share their stories from Kerala, photographs and videos.

The other major features of the website include short video clips that give glimpses of Kerala, a video gallery with a collection of 360-degree videos and royalty-free videos, besides a picture gallery from where pictures can be used by tourism stakeholders.

Launched in 1998, www.keralatourism.org has played a major role in promoting the tourism initiatives of the Department of Tourism. The website has bagged numerous national and global honours including the best among 10 tourism websites in Asia Pacific and the Middle East.

Kerala Tourism Director, Sikha Surendran and Kerala Tourism Additional Director, Vishnu Raj P were also present.
